Hephaestus was the only one on Mt. Olympus who wasn't 'perfect' - he had a bum leg.  Not that he was born that way but one day Daddy was hurting Mommy over something and Hephaestus tried to intervene.

Daddy (a.k.a. Zeus) responded by tossing Hephaestus off Mt. Olympus, shattering the god's leg so it healed crippled.  After that, Hephaestus was the most loyal of Zeus' children - it was Hephaestus who forged the lightening bolts that Zeus tossed around.

To me, this story defines that god's mindset.
